Verbal reasoning worksheet: Hidden words practice

Verbal reasoning: Hidden words practice

In these questions you are asked to find a word that is hidden in a sentence. The hidden word will be spread over two consecutive words.

Verbal reasoning worksheet: Compound words

Verbal reasoning: Compound words

From rainbow and football to breakfast, you use compound words every day – they are simply larger words made up from two smaller words. In verbal reasoning you are often asked to identify and work with compound words. Can you come up with a list of 20 compound words?

Verbal reasoning worksheet: Compound words practice

Verbal reasoning: Compound words practice

This worksheet looks at compound words. In these questions a word from the first set of brackets joins one word from the second set of brackets to make a new word known as a compound word. The left-hand word always comes first. Select two words each time.
